Originally Posted by javabytes
Per the strict terms of the certs, you must fly by the expiration date.

As a practical matter, has anyone booked a flight, applied an RUC/GUC that cleared instantly, gotten the ticket reissued (a critical piece here), and flown up front after the cert expiration? That's the way the old SWUs used to work. And I know just because the T&C say something doesn't mean DL's best-in-class IT enforces it.
The SWU T&C allowed one to fly BE up to one year after the original expiration date if the ticket was reissued, but the rules for GUCs clearly say this is not possible.

On the other hand, I extended 4 SWUs on Feb 27 by buying two refundable B fares and the next day my SWUs showed up at expired. I called DL and was told they were gone, but my BE codes and seats are still in place. I guess the drama begins when I have to reissue those tickets yet again for one reason or another.

Just an update. I called and got nowhere. At first they said they could apply them if there was space available and there was but then during that process (which included me waiting for about 20 minutes), they realized their mistake and shut me down.

I then tried to use them on a flight I'm taking with my wife and kid flying on a companion pass. Again got pretty far along before the agent realized you can't use them with companion tickets (I didn't know that either).

Finally, I emailed Delta today and received a pretty quick response saying that they would not extend my certs by 3 months as I had requested. Disappointing to say the least.

I also didn't realize you can transfer them to others anymore. I have to say, I generally keep up with the program but the amount of changes they make to these things makes it pretty hard to know exactly what you have unless you read the terms each time. A little frustrating as a premium traveler and the loss of those two GUCs means I will probably switch to BA sooner rather than later (I'm moving to London in a few months).

In positive news, I was able to use my 2015 GUCs immediately to upgrade my trip to and from London in a couple weeks

Originally Posted by lamont2718
This is not a change. SWUs were not transferable, and neither were PMUs (which predated the DL/NW merger).
You can transfer old SWUs or GUCs/RUCs to a single companion traveling with you, officially on the same PNR but I don't think that was always enforced.

AFAIK the rule for any sort of companion upgrade has always been that neither the elite nor the companion can be flying on an award ticket or using pay with miles. Moreover, SWUs and GUCs/RUCs were never allowed to be applied to award tickets.
